Transaction 27a274398081b39afe5d3a920202f6edeb739ba44eb8529deddd960f9f998906

1 Input
2 Outputs
  • 27a274398081b39afe5d3a920202f6edeb739ba44eb8529deddd960f9f998906:0
  • value  275666
    address  352RrFccubq8s1tqrL3KQF1hfyLvREWudk
  • 27a274398081b39afe5d3a920202f6edeb739ba44eb8529deddd960f9f998906:1
  • value  21383289
    address  35S4KSoxexsCEdKUW6EksUY8UHmWF26KL2